Transaction 309176cfcb706f7346d78333590b5b164795642ba0d5771a502528d337de2a5c

1 Input
2 Outputs
  • 309176cfcb706f7346d78333590b5b164795642ba0d5771a502528d337de2a5c:0
  • value  1107700
    address  1Ljdj2g8rhd4HhnnhvJmWoJrPFh4eqoe6z
  • 309176cfcb706f7346d78333590b5b164795642ba0d5771a502528d337de2a5c:1
  • value  22925258
    address  3G5p5PKNSGrfb8Yt8hm3Hw1xQxNMunFykd